Nnnvba macro to open pdf files

This will help us to re use the open workbook in the program. Some messages will not open with double click but will open with file open. Thats wrong, a pdf is a file and can be read like other files. Therefore i have written a function isfileopen which takes the complete path of that file with file name as an input. We can use close method of workbook to close the file. Speed up excel macro bn copy and paste external files. Macro to save a file in excel and pdf solved auto open word document in excel hyperlink fonts in ms word document and pdf excel personal. Sub openfile dim filenameref as string filenameref application. If you need to make modifications, hopefully, you will be able to follow along with my code comments and customize the code to. Solved excel will not open macro enabled workbooks. Hi everyone, we have several elogs in the ms excel platform. When scenario 3 happens, i want the macro to recognize that the current open excel document is the one it needs to add additional information to. Vba code for closing active workbook macro should work for all the version of microsoft excel 2003, excel 2007, excel 2010, and excel. I was able to open pdf files from all subfolders of a folder and copy content to the macro enabled workbook using shell as recommended above.

If adobe reader is installed on your computer, but your pdf files are not opening with adobe reader. The oreilly book pdf hacks describes many ways to use it. If a pdf file is found, the macro opens it, reads specific fields from the file and writes the values in the sheet read. Save the macro and the form, then click that sucker and see it work.

Sub openpdf dim pdf as acropddoc dim strpdf as string set pdf createobjectacroexch. You can normally open pdfs automatically in chrome by clicking on the file you want to see. Open most recent version of file in folder microsoft. How to search a pdf for a string using vba for excel vba. Open pdf, vba code, adobe readerprofessional, specific pageview. How to make your pdfs open with adobe reader on windows 8. I am running into trouble when i try to open a file over the internet. Creating pdf file from excel using vba script adobe acrobat windows. My accounting system produces pdfs in some kind of proprietary pdf reader. It doesnt have near the feature set of foxit, my preferred reader. To open these files, you will need adobe reader software on macintosh os 89 or windows systems. Id like to open a pdf file using an excel vba macro. Apr 16, 2014 hi i have in folder 30 to 50 pdf files i want one by one open pdf files.

I can get it to open the file in adobe but cant seem to get it to print the file and close. Close current file, open next in folder not iterating. Then browse and select the file that you want to open. Filedialog to give the user an option to select a file and then open it. It populates the tables directly from a folderdirectory either with all files of the type chosen or single files. Dec 17, 20 excel will not open macro enabled workbooks. The pdf toolkit is an alternative to doing this with the acrobat reader. Or give me any other hints why it doesnt print for me. We will look at two examples, one that works with acrobat reader and a second that should be used if you have acrobat pro licensed version. The following excel vba example will open the test.

I need to find and replace uriuri with launchf to prevent local files from opening in a web browser. Microsoft access cant invoke the application runapp action. The first macro i was testing changes a filter in a pivot table and saves a pdf copy does this 3 times. Mar 18, 20 several years ago i needed to open the newest csv file from a particular directory. If you want, you can change the paths to anything else you want to open. Macro open workbook, copy and close solutions experts. Getexecutablepathpdf get the path to acrobat reader if. Please will someone prove me wrong and point me in the right direction for code samples etc.

Solved pdf files in word created on mac do not display on windows solved hyperlink how do you want to open this file. Solved excel will not open macro enabled workbooks spiceworks. There are a lot of merged cells and a lot of ifs to be used in the vba for range selection. In this we will simply open the pdf file specified, using followhyperlink.

Since the logic of copying from an external workbook to a sheet within the current workbook is consistent, only the locations and filenames are changing, its easier to create a common method with parameters to normalize whats being done. Could it be that i need to change the parameters after the file name. As soon as the commandbutton open pdf is pressed i would like the macro to open a pdf file from a certain location. Nov 04, 2015 solved pdf files in word created on mac do not display on windows solved hyperlink how do you want to open this file. Youll probably agree with me that using this method of. You can, of course, open a text file straight from excel. It is a free command line tool that can manipulate pdfs in a great number of ways. Mar 21, 2007 to overcome this i use an ole object for pdf files. Pdf files are downloading instead of displaying in web browser or.

Several years ago i needed to open the newest csv file from a particular directory. In this article we will see how you can search for a string in a pdf file and highlight it using excel vba. Shell function in vba open pdf file using vba youtube. Creating pdf file from excel using vba script adobe. With vba code each names pdf files need to be opened and book mark the pages accordingly as updated next to name updated in excel. Opening pdfs in word word office support office 365. It opens the file dialog box from where a user can select multiple excel files, which he wants to open. View document thumbnails or outline the slider button on the far left will open a sidebar with thumbnails of the documents pages. A combination of various api functions is used in order to find and manipulate the page number and page. Creating a button to open pdf file in access but keep gettin a error. Instead of fighting it, now i immediately save the pdf and open it in foxit. Creating a button to open pdf file in access but keep.

Excel macro to open and print multiple pdf files showing 17 of 7 messages. Check if file is already open using excel vba learn excel macro. Jun 24, 2008 the apache openoffice user forum is an user to user help and discussion forum for exchanging information and tips with other users of apache openoffice, the open source office suite. The problem is the macro, when run through this function multiple times creates several copies of the errors document, which is very annoying. Opening and closing pdfs using vba excelaccess 2007. Hello, i have managed to put up following codes to open pdf file and folder containing other files. The name of the pdf file changes, but always has the same base name followed by the date it was last updated. Before opening that file, it is always a good idea to check if that file is already open or not. If a file has each item on a line separated with the tab character then it is said to be a txt file. Solved vbs script open file, run macro but does not save. The slowest part of your macro will be the opening of each excel spreadsheet file. What i seek to accomplish is to have a button that opens a pdf file for the selected record.

Files ending in csv are, however, a common format, and well stick with those types of files. Creating pdf file from excel using vba script adobe acrobat. Anyway heres another go sub existingtonew dim wbnew as workbook dim wbexisting as workbook dim wsexisting as worksheet set wbexisting workbooks. Read and write pdf forms from excel vba my engineering. Vba display a file open dialog and open the file excel. Im trying to use a visual basic for applications vba macro to output reports to pdf files. A user can click on open multiple files button to run the macro. How can i use to vba open a pdf file over the internet. Dear lem readers, while doing programming with vba many a times it happens to open an existing file. Give the whole path and the filename of the pdf file that you want to open. I attached a sample of the log all of the confidential information has been changed and our.

Download the attachment open the folder openwithhyperlinks open the workbook openthingies click one of the forms buttons on the sheet. Next to the programpath name field, click on the browse button to open the browse for an executable window. The code is well commented and should be self explanatory. My end result that i am almost at is to open the spreadsheet during nonworking hours using task scheduler, refresh a query, refresh the pivot table, filter and save pivot table as pdfs, and then email the pdfs to the plant managers. Can anyone give me some examples or steer me in the right direction. Excel vba open an excel file and run a macro actuarial.

Macro open workbook, copy and close solutions experts exchange. Once all the files are selected, click on ok button to open all the selected files. Find answers to creating a button to open pdf file in access but keep gettin a error. On the other hand, the readpdfforms macro loops through all the files in the specified folder forms. Below is a simple vba macro that will allow you to quickly turn your selected worksheet s into a pdf file in a snap. A combination of various api functions is used in order to find. Select the file to be opened and click on the open button in the lowerright corner of the open dialog. I will have the directory path in a cell column header path but i am unsure of how to write the macro vba code to open the selected file. Finally open the pdf document and print when the button is clicked.

The code is written to save your document in the same folder as the excel file currently resides. I have created a similar database to yourself which opens most types of files including excel, word, pdf, music, video, htm, html. Macro express will open the program that is associated with the file type and then open your file. Outlook 2010 vba to open each pdf file in a subfolder. Vba to open a pdf, print, then close stumped excel. Jul 31, 2012 demonstration of vba code used to open a pdf file from different office applications. Apr 29, 20 demonstration of vba code used in opening a pdf file from different office applications. Did this further, by creating multiple files with old dates, and it is grabbing the first date. Demonstration of vba code used in opening a pdf file from different office applications. To overcome this i use an ole object for pdf files. So id like to ask if it is possible to define a macro or maybe a tool on future releases to open the file manager in current folder.

Hi all, ive got most of this worked out in terms of going to the subfolder and marking read emails and the like, but dealing with myshell is. Now i have tried to do it with the same file saved as april. A more generic vba code that works with both adobe reader and professional can be found here. Print, merged cells, and vba hello im looking for a code that will help me with a print job for a worksheet. Vba code to close the excel file example will help us to close the excel file. The full file path will be stored in fullpath variable, which is used later in the code to open the file after making sure there was an excel file selected. In the code to print the file, give the full path to the adobe reader, acrobat or any pdf reader on your computer.

I have in folder 30 to 50 pdf files i want one by one open pdf files. Here we are opening the workbook and setting to an object. This is about using vbams access to send existing pdf files to a printer. The first name and last name column in each row are combined to create the name of the pdf file. The code i posted copies the worksheet and then converts to value. Converting from pdf to word works best with files that are mostly textfor example, business, legal, or scientific documents. In this example we will see how to close the active excel workbook using vba. Now select fileclose and return to microsoft excel dont forget to save your changes. Dim app as acroapp dim pddoc as acropddoc dim path1 as string. And more precisely, how could i open a pdf file to a specific page i. I need to click on a pdf file and then select open with and select excel as my choice. I asked the question a couple of years ago about a macro that would open a spreadsheet based on a file path listed in a certain cell, print the spreadsheet, close the spreadsheet, and move to. And more precisely, how could i open a pdf file to a particular page i.

Demonstration of vba code used to open a pdf file from different office applications. However, there is a way to open a pdf from an office application even with adobe reader. Hi all, ive got most of this worked out in terms of going to the subfolder and marking read emails and the like, but dealing with myshell is presenting a bit of a challenge. The challenging part was to use the pdf objects from vba, so i searched for adobe sdk to find the vocabulary that uses adobe in their programs acrobat reader. I am trying to use excel vba to open a pdf file and copy the image. Different ways to access pdf files with firefox firefox help. Download the attachment open the folder openwithhyperlinks open the workbook openthingies click one of. Of course, you can use this same method to open any document from any valid application, even text files in notepad. I will have the directory path in a cell column header path but i am unsure of how to write the macrovba code to open the selected file. The data from each row is used to create a new pdf file, which is saved in the forms subfolder. Creating a button to open pdf file in access but keep gettin. If i run macro then from that folder i want to open 1 pdf file when i close that file then open 2nd pdf file like this. Here i get a sub or function not defined which makes sense because it is in the workbook i am opening and is not defined until that workbook is open what i want it to do next is run the macro in the newly opened file and then save the file with a new name and close it. The apache openoffice user forum is an user to user help and discussion forum for exchanging information and tips with other users of apache openoffice, the open source office suite.

63 1474 1430 1314 1496 1545 1025 908 54 766 1149 1432 451 817 258 1560 1173 1472 1147 174 432 1263 925 1513 933 1426 522 179 401 574 859 1086 1016 1212 295 1122 1197 671 675 716